Real Estate: Top five ways to increase property value



There are more than 101 ways to increase the value of your property, but there are far fewer ways of adding value without spending a significant amount of money on home renovations.

As the global housing market has come to a halt, many homeowners are turning to better interior designs and furnishings to beautify their homes and try to increase the value of their property.

It is not always easy to work out what could be done to increase the value of your property, however there are a few things to avoid. Research has found that having a hot tub can take a toll on the value of your home (parents worry about safety and maintenance costs) and the installation of new carpet and flooring has a very minimal impact on the value of your property.

Increasing the value of your property sounds straightforward enough, but it is often trickier than many of us realize and we can often get it wrong.

Take a look at these five straightforward ways to increase the value of your property:

1- Let in the light

When you are looking to sell your home, it’s vital that you make every inch of your house as bright as possible. This can easily be achieved by allowing as much natural light through your home as possible; you may need to consider investing in some newer, lighter window coverings and ditching the old dusty curtains.

If you allow natural light in your home and place mirrors on the adjacent wall, the light will reflect throughout the round to create the illusion of spaciousness, even in the smallest of rooms.

It’s crucial that when you are showing potential buyers around your home that your entrance hall is warm, clean and inviting. Remember that homebuyers will judge your home within seconds so it’s crucial that they don’t see your home as a dark dungeon.

2- Go minimalist

When you have been living in a place for more than five years, you often acquire a large amount of unnecessary clutter and furnishings. It’s advisable to de-clutter your home and remove any unnecessary items that are taking up valuable space; buyers are looking for space and with a minimalist style your home may appear warmer and more open.

You should find that with the de-cluttering of your home the more light comes through your rooms, as it has less obstacles blocking its path.

3- Opt for renewable energy

With energy prices rising around the world, buyers are now looking for energy efficient homes. There are many ways in which a home can become energy efficient. If you are looking for short term solutions to add value to your property consider investing in energy-efficient appliances. These offer the user a more energy-efficient way to use appliances and saves homeowners hundreds in utility bills.

You can easily find energy-efficient washers, dryers, fridges and freezers with grade A* energy-efficiency ratings in your local stores. Green homes give homebuyers the impression that your home is a safe and economical property worth investing in.

4- Build an extension

Not always the first option to consider but if you have the financial means then you could seriously improve the value of your home with an extra bedroom, bathroom or even a garage.

Even though an investment in your property is favorable to increase the asking price for your property, it’s important to note that it is a time-consuming project that requires some serious investment and so should not be taken lightly.

Never build extensions that don’t match the rest of the home household, as this will take away the uniformity of the home and stick out like a sore thumb.

5- Make the important rooms count

Research has found that the average value added to a property by replacing an old kitchen with a new one is $4,000, and $2,000 for a bathroom. If you feel that you can do a good job on a bathroom, you could try and save yourself a third of the cost of hiring a builder by renovating it yourself. You can purchase show room model bathroom materials and do some research for tips on how to install them.
